Fantasy, Scherzo and
Nocturne for Saxophone Quartet (1974)
11 min.
First prize, Aspen Music Festival Composers' Competition, 1974.
Many hundreds of performances by professional and collegiate quartets.
“One hopes that many college ensembles will add this interesting selection to
the short list of American saxophone quartets.”
— MLA Notes (Steve Mauk), September 1979.
"The
Fantasy is a lovely lyrical movement in medium tempo, followed by the
fast, playful Scherzo. The slow Nocturne begins with a lovely duo
for tenor and baritone saxophones. This is a dramatic and emotional movement...
It's a good piece for both college students and professional players. The
ensemble writing is excellent, with all four voices getting a chance to sing
out. It is a remarkable work from such a young composer."
-Susan Fancher,
Saxophone Journal, September/October 2007
Published by Tenuto Publications (494-02801, $14.95).

Fast Walk
for Saxophone Quartet (1989, this version 1991)
2½ min.
Hundreds of performances by San Francisco
Saxophone Quartet and Amherst Saxophone Quartet
Recorded by the Harmo Saxophone Quartet on Meister Music CD MM-1016 (Japan).
"This
short, upbeat piece makes a terrific opener for a concert, or as the first piece
after intermission."
-Susan Fancher,
Saxophone Journal, September/October 2007

It Takes Four to Tango
for Saxophone Quartet (1990, adapted 1995)
2½ min.
Premiere by Harmo Saxophone Quartet,
Tokyo, 1995.
CD recording by the Harmo Saxophone Quartet on Meister Music CD MM-1016 (Japan).
CD recording by The Osland Saxophone Quartet, Sea Breeze Records SB-3059.
"It
is a wonderful little soprano saxophone feature. You could program this anywhere
on a concert, either on its own or right after Fast Walk, for example. It
can be played "straight" as written, or more inflected in a jazz
style."
-Susan Fancher,
Saxophone Journal, September/October 2007
